PAINTING CONTRACTOR KILLED IN TRUCK CRASH, VEHICLE SLAMMED INTO HOUSE

Date:

Mark Carden, 58, was killed on Wednesday, May 8, 2024, on The Plaza Charlotte, NC. Mark was a painting and wallpaper contractor for over 20 years.

Mark Carden

At 5:43 p.m. Mark was driving a Chevrolet Silverado truck on The Plaza. Mark lost control veered off the right side of the roadway, struck a guide wire, side swiped a tree and then ran head on into a residence.

It is believed Mark had a medical emergency that led to him driving off the road. Emergency personnel discovered Mark unresponsive in the driver’s seat of the vehicle.

Medic transported Mark to Novant Health Presbyterian Medical Center where he was pronounced deceased, authorities say.

No one was in the residence during the crash.
